Transaction 05c43880612440f163745e70b3d6f568e3aa9c3f01571a05a39d921f854c8e5e

1 Input
2 Outputs
  • 05c43880612440f163745e70b3d6f568e3aa9c3f01571a05a39d921f854c8e5e:0
  • value  50781250
    address  mr9bYzukPFNd8mFBY8BcSgnjP225vTu1xe
  • 05c43880612440f163745e70b3d6f568e3aa9c3f01571a05a39d921f854c8e5e:1
  • value  4949118750
    address  mx4VAMuSDMpX7sXCUhgwX1ZonFxQ4i1e6Z